3686 - 中彩票

题目描述

今天是个好日子,小明和小红想买个彩票试一下自己的手气。他们买的彩票是这样兑奖的,只要买到的彩票号码中包含长度大于等于 2 的回文数就判定中奖了。现在请你编写一个程序帮小明和小红检查一下他们是否中奖。

提示:回文数指的是从左向右读和从右向左读都是一样的整数。例如 22 是长度为 2 的回文数,654456 是长度为 6 的回文数。

输入

共三行。

第一行为一个整数 n,代表小明和小红买到的彩票号码长度。

第二行为小明买到的彩票号码。

第三行为小红买到的彩票号码。

输出

只有一个单词。若两人均中奖,输出All;若小明中奖,输出Ming;若小红中奖,输出Hong;若两人均未中奖,则输出No

样例

输入

6
172275
654321

输出

Ming
说明

样例解释

小明的彩票号码中有 7227 这个长度为 4 的回文数, 而小红的彩票号码中没有出现回文数,所以只有小明中奖了。

数据范围

对于 60 \%的数据,保证输入的 n \leq 10000 ,且彩票号码符合特殊性质 1

对于 100\%的数据,保证输入的 n \leq 1000000 ,数据点 7-8 符合特殊性质 2,数据的 9-10 无特殊性质。

特殊性质解释

特殊性质 1:彩票号码只有两种情况,要么自己本身是一个回文数,要么不包含回文数。

特殊性质 2:彩票号码若包含回文数,则回文数一定在正中间。

来源

BCSP-X小高组编程能力样卷-T1

标签
题目参数
时间限制 1 秒
内存限制 128 MB
提交次数 18
通过人数 4
金币数量 1 枚
难度 入门


上一题 下一题